%{
#include "step.tab.h"
#include "recfile.ph"
#include "stdio.h"
#include <StepFile_CallFailure.hxx>
/* skl 31.01.2002 for OCC133(OCC96,97) - uncorrect
long string in files Henri.stp and 401.stp*/
#define YY_FATAL_ERROR(msg) StepFile_CallFailure( msg )
/* abv 07.06.02: force inclusion of stdlib.h on WNT to avoid warnings */
#include <stdlib.h>
/*
void steperror ( FILE *input_file );
void steprestart ( FILE *input_file );
*/
void rec_restext(char *newtext, int lentext);
void rec_typarg(int argtype);
int steplineno; /* Comptage de ligne (ben oui, fait tout faire) */
int modcom = 0; /* Commentaires type C */
int modend = 0; /* Flag for finishing of the STEP file */
void resultat () /* Resultat alloue dynamiquement, "jete" une fois lu */
{ if (modcom == 0) rec_restext(yytext,yyleng); }
%}
%%
" " {;}
" " {;}
[\n] { steplineno ++; }
[\r] {;} /* abv 30.06.00: for reading DOS files */
[\0]+ {;} /* fix from C21. for test load e3i file with line 15 with null symbols */
#[0-9]+/= { resultat(); if (modcom == 0) return(ENTITY); }
#[0-9]+/[ ]*= { resultat(); if (modcom == 0) return(ENTITY); }
#[0-9]+ { resultat(); if (modcom == 0) return(IDENT); }
[-+0-9][0-9]* { resultat(); if (modcom == 0) { rec_typarg(rec_argInteger); return(QUID); } }
[-+\.0-9][\.0-9]+ { resultat(); if (modcom == 0) { rec_typarg(rec_argFloat); return(QUID); } }
[-+\.0-9][\.0-9]+E[-+0-9][0-9]* { resultat(); if (modcom == 0) { rec_typarg(rec_argFloat); return(QUID); } }
[\']([\n]|[\000\011-\046\050-\176\201-\237\240-\777]|[\047][\047])*[\'] { resultat(); if (modcom == 0) { rec_typarg(rec_argText); return(QUID); } }
["][0-9A-F]+["] { resultat(); if (modcom == 0) { rec_typarg(rec_argHexa); return(QUID); } }
[.][A-Z0-9_]+[.] { resultat(); if (modcom == 0) { rec_typarg(rec_argEnum); return(QUID); } }
[(] { if (modcom == 0) return ('('); }
[)] { if (modcom == 0) return (')'); }
[,] { if (modcom == 0) return (','); }
[$] { resultat(); if (modcom == 0) { rec_typarg(rec_argNondef); return(QUID); } }
[=] { if (modcom == 0) return ('='); }
[;] { if (modcom == 0) return (';'); }
"/*" { modcom = 1; }
"*/" { if (modend == 0) modcom = 0; }
STEP; { if (modcom == 0) return(STEP); }
HEADER; { if (modcom == 0) return(HEADER); }
ENDSEC; { if (modcom == 0) return(ENDSEC); }
DATA; { if (modcom == 0) return(DATA); }
ENDSTEP; { if (modend == 0) {modcom = 0; return(ENDSTEP);} }
"ENDSTEP;".* { if (modend == 0) {modcom = 0; return(ENDSTEP);} }
END-ISO[0-9\-]*; { modcom = 1; modend = 1; return(ENDSTEP); }
ISO[0-9\-]*; { if (modend == 0) {modcom = 0; return(STEP); } }
[/] { if (modcom == 0) return ('/'); }
&SCOPE { if (modcom == 0) return(SCOPE); }
ENDSCOPE { if (modcom == 0) return(ENDSCOPE); }
[a-zA-Z0-9_]+ { resultat(); if (modcom == 0) return(TYPE); }
![a-zA-Z0-9_]+ { resultat(); if (modcom == 0) return(TYPE); }
[^)] { resultat(); if (modcom == 0) { rec_typarg(rec_argMisc); return(QUID); } }
